Here's some information about this type of solar panel: Polycrystalline: Polycrystalline solar panels are made from multiple silicon fragments melted together. They are less efficient than monocrystalline panels but tend to be more affordable. They are recognizable by their blue or speckled appearance. 335 Watt: This indicates the power output of the solar panel under standard test conditions (STC). A 335-watt solar panel should produce 335 watts of electricity in one hour of direct sunlight. 72 Cells: The number of cells refers to the number of individual solar cells connected in series within the solar panel. 72 cells are a common configuration for residential and commercial solar panels. 24 Volts: This is the nominal voltage of the solar panel.
